How we can help.

We offer Individual Therapy, Couples Therapy, Family Therapy, Child & Teen Therapy, and Psychological Assessments.

We are committed to providing therapy to people of all races, gender, sexual orientation, ability, religion, background, and nationality. We understand that an individual’s experiences and social context are integral to their identity and mental health.

We also provide corporate / EAP services, coaching, talks, screenings, and workshops.
